How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Strawberry Manor?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Strawberry Manor Studio Apartments | $1,618 | $1,350 | $1,825 |
| Strawberry Manor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,627 | $1,125 | $2,467 |
Strawberry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,009 | $1,447 | $2,948 |
| Strawberry Manor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,343 | $898 | $3,803 |
| Strawberry Manor 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,485 | $988 | $3,982 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Strawberry Manor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Strawberry Manor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Strawberry Manor is $2,009.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Strawberry Manor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Strawberry Manor is a 1,165 square feet unit starting from $2,799 at The Eames.
What is the average size for Strawberry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Strawberry Manor is currently 933 sq ft.
